#[cfg(unix)]
fn print_help() {
print!(
"Usage: date [OPTION]... [+FORMAT]\n\
\x20 or: date [-u|--utc|--universal] [MMDDhhmm[[CC]YY][.ss]]\n\
Display the current time in the given FORMAT, or set the system date.\n\n\
\x20 -d, --date=STRING display time described by STRING\n\
\x20 -f, --file=DATEFILE like --date; once for each line of DATEFILE\n\
\x20 -I[FMT], --iso-8601[=FMT] output date/time in ISO 8601 format.\n\
\x20 FMT='date' for date only (the default),\n\
\x20 'hours', 'minutes', 'seconds', or 'ns'\n\
\x20 -R, --rfc-email output date and time in RFC 5322 format\n\
\x20 --rfc-3339=FMT output date/time in RFC 3339 format.\n\
\x20 FMT='date', 'seconds', or 'ns'\n\
\x20 -r, --reference=FILE display the last modification time of FILE\n\
\x20 -s, --set=STRING set time described by STRING\n\
\x20 -u, --utc, --universal print or set Coordinated Universal Time (UTC)\n\
\x20 --help display this help and exit\n\
\x20 --version output version information and exit\n\n\
FORMAT controls the output. Interpreted sequences are:\n\n\
\x20 %% a literal %\n\
\x20 %a locale's abbreviated weekday name (e.g., Sun)\n\
\x20 %A locale's full weekday name (e.g., Sunday)\n\
\x20 %b locale's abbreviated month name (e.g., Jan)\n\
\x20 %B locale's full month name (e.g., January)\n\
\x20 %c locale's date and time (e.g., Thu Mar 3 23:05:25 2005)\n\
\x20 %C century; like %Y, except omit last two digits (e.g., 20)\n\
\x20 %d day of month (e.g., 01)\n\
\x20 %D date; same as %m/%d/%y\n\
\x20 %e day of month, space padded; same as %_d\n\
\x20 %F full date; like %+4Y-%m-%d\n\
\x20 %H hour (00..23)\n\
\x20 %I hour (01..12)\n\
\x20 %j day of year (001..366)\n\
\x20 %k hour, space padded ( 0..23); same as %_H\n\
\x20 %l hour, space padded ( 1..12); same as %_I\n\
\x20 %m month (01..12)\n\
\x20 %M minute (00..59)\n\
\x20 %N nanoseconds (000000000..999999999)\n\
\x20 %p locale's equivalent of either AM or PM\n\
\x20 %P like %p, but lower case\n\
\x20 %r locale's 12-hour clock time (e.g., 11:11:04 PM)\n\
\x20 %R 24-hour hour and minute; same as %H:%M\n\
\x20 %s seconds since the Epoch (1970-01-01 00:00 UTC)\n\
\x20 %S second (00..60)\n\
\x20 %T time; same as %H:%M:%S\n\
\x20 %u day of week (1..7); 1 is Monday\n\
\x20 %V ISO week number, with Monday as first day of week (01..53)\n\
\x20 %w day of week (0..6); 0 is Sunday\n\
\x20 %x locale's date representation\n\
\x20 %X locale's time representation\n\
\x20 %y last two digits of year (00..99)\n\
\x20 %Y year\n\
\x20 %z +hhmm numeric time zone (e.g., -0400)\n\
\x20 %Z alphabetic time zone abbreviation (e.g., EDT)\n"
);
}
